How to Set Up Tensorflow, OpenCV, and NumPy WebDue to incompatibility between the CPU (armv8) and the compiler (arm-linux-gnueabihf), Paddle cannot be installed on a Raspberry Pi 4 with a 32-bit operating system. The generated library uses registers (VFPV3) missing in the armv8. Replacing a compiler can be a real nightmare. Best to take a new SD card and install the latest Raspberry 64-bit OS.

WebTensorFlow Lite Posenet running at 9.4 FPS on bare Raspberry Pi 4 with Ubuntu. A fast C++ implementation of TensorFlow Lite Posenet on a bare Raspberry Pi 4 64-bit OS. Once overclocked to 1825 MHz, the app runs at 9.4 FPS without any hardware accelerator.
